Google's flagship Pixel 10 Pro Fold is now available for $1,499, a $300 (17%) discount from its $1,799 price, as part of early Black Friday promotions at Amazon and Best Buy, with similar reductions across all storage options. Other Pixel models, including the Pixel 10 Pro at $749 and Pixel 10 Pro XL 1TB at $1,249, are also seeing significant price cuts. This aggressive holiday season pricing strategy for its hardware portfolio could indicate a push by Alphabet to boost market share or manage inventory, potentially influencing the company's hardware division revenue and margins.

Alphabet (GOOGL, GOOG) has initiated aggressive early Black Friday pricing for its flagship Pixel 10 Pro Fold, offering a $300 or 17% discount, reducing its price to $1,499 from $1,799 across all storage configurations. This significant markdown, available at major retailers like Amazon (AMZN) and Best Buy (BBY), comes shortly after the device's late August launch, indicating a strategic push during the critical holiday shopping season. The Pixel 10 Pro Fold, which received an 88 in a recent review for its improved durability (IP68), upgraded software, and superior camera system among flexible phones, is now more competitively priced. This aggressive pricing strategy for its hardware portfolio, including record lows for the Pixel 10 Pro ($749) and Pixel 10 Pro XL 1TB ($1,249), suggests Alphabet aims to boost market share and manage inventory ahead of year-end.
